Understanding UIC60 Rail

The UIC60 rail, developed in accordance with the International Union of Railways (UIC) standards, has been integral to modern railway infrastructure. This specific rail profile is known for its robustness and adaptability, making it suitable for extensive applications in both freight and passenger services.

Expert Insights on UIC60 Rail

1. Enhancing Performance with UIC60 Rail

According to Dr. Linda Schwartz, a civil engineer specializing in railway technologies, “The UIC60 rail has proven to enhance the performance of railway networks due to its higher weight per meter compared to older rail types. This added weight helps in reducing vibrations and noise levels, making it a preferred choice for urban rail projects.”

2. Maintenance Efficiency

Mark Johnson, a rail maintenance expert, emphasizes, “One of the key advantages of using UIC60 rail is that it requires less frequent maintenance. The durability of this rail profile leads to lower lifecycle costs. This makes it a smart investment for rail operators looking to optimize their maintenance schedules and budgets.”

3. Safety Considerations

Safety is paramount in railway systems. Johannes Miller, a railway safety consultant, states, “Using UIC60 rail not only complies with international standards but also improves safety metrics on rail lines. Its structural integrity offers resistance to deformities under heavy loads, greatly reducing the likelihood of derailments.”
